Transaction f7b804529b773d6e5da71107258416750ddd48e16fdb4a356ac585ba5e2c6e89

4 Input
2 Outputs
  • f7b804529b773d6e5da71107258416750ddd48e16fdb4a356ac585ba5e2c6e89:0
  • value  2473685078
    address  1vhk5DCCuhmivHMuHmZLPP6bwkSf2TTzY
  • f7b804529b773d6e5da71107258416750ddd48e16fdb4a356ac585ba5e2c6e89:1
  • value  98672562
    address  12dRugNcdxK39288NjcDV4GX7rMsKCGn6B